Fabrikit is the Thornwick platform's test-data factory library, used by plugin authors to seed realistic fixtures in sandbox environments. Each plugin gets one service account scoped to its own namespace; accounts cannot read fixtures created by other plugins. Seeding requests go through the Fabrikit gateway, which enforces quota limits of 10,000 records per hour. Service accounts are provisioned by the platform team and renewed quarterly. To call the gateway during plugin development, use the shared sandbox service key listed below.

gateway credential: kto23_LX9A4ys6i4nzHtpOLNLodKK

Onboarding note for this week's eng sync: the GalleryWhisper audio-guide app now uses a shared staging account for testing tour playback and beacon triggers. New engineers should request access through the team lead and complete the device pairing walkthrough before Thursday. If the staging account is locked after failed pairing attempts, the recovery flow requires the team passphrase to restore access. Please do not store it in personal notes; it rotates quarterly. The current recovery passphrase is:

vault phrase of tajef-tafog = istox-sorax-zorox-casok-holox-kelix-weneth-drueth-casion

## Ownership

So, who owns ParityPeek? Short version: the rate-parity checker is maintained by the Lodging Tools squad at Quillhaven. If a hotel reports mismatched rates between channels, don't panic — first check the scraper status page, since most "parity violations" are just stale crawls. Escalate only if the discrepancy persists past two refresh cycles. Feature requests go in the ParityPeek backlog, not support chat. For anything urgent or ambiguous, the person to ping is:

account owner for bawip-tahag: Raleth Quenok